util.startup: Always apply umask (thanks Max Hearnden)
Commit c673ff1075bd removed mod_posix, and moved functionality into
util.startup, including applying a secure umask at runtime. However, the
new function was not called from the startup sequence, leading Prosody to run
with whatever umask it inherited from the environment.
Prosody Debian packages ship with a secure umask 027 in the systemd unit file
for the prosody service, so Debian systems using systemd are not affected.
prosodyctl calls the switch_user() function during startup, which would set
the umask, so prosodyctl commands which created files were unaffected.
This change makes both prosody and prosodyctl unconditionally set a secure
umask during the startup process.

describe("parse", function() local parse setup(function() parse = require"util.argparse".parse; end); it("works", function() -- basic smoke test local opts = parse({ "--help" }); assert.same({ help = true }, opts); end); it("returns if no args", function() assert.same({}, parse({})); end); it("supports boolean flags", function() local opts, err = parse({ "--foo"; "--no-bar" }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({ foo = true; bar = false }, opts); end); it("consumes input until the first argument", function() local arg = { "--foo"; "bar"; "--baz" }; local opts, err = parse(arg);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({ foo = true, "bar", "--baz" }, opts); assert.same({ "bar"; "--baz" }, arg); end); it("allows continuation beyond first positional argument", function() local arg = { "--foo"; "bar"; "--baz" }; local opts, err = parse(arg, { stop_on_positional = false }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({ foo = true, baz = true, "bar" }, opts); -- All input should have been consumed: assert.same({ }, arg); end); it("expands short options", function() do local opts, err = parse({ "--foo"; "-b" }, { short_params = { b = "bar" } }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({ foo = true; bar = true }, opts); end do -- Same test with strict mode enabled and all parameters declared local opts, err = parse({ "--foo"; "-b" }, { kv_params = { foo = true, bar = true }; short_params = { b = "bar" }, strict = true }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({ foo = true; bar = true }, opts); end end); it("supports value arguments", function() local opts, err = parse({ "--foo"; "bar"; "--baz=moo" }, { value_params = { foo = true; bar = true } }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({ foo = "bar"; baz = "moo" }, opts); end); it("supports value arguments in strict mode", function() local opts, err = parse({ "--foo"; "bar"; "--baz=moo" }, { strict = true, value_params = { foo = true; baz = true } }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({ foo = "bar"; baz = "moo" }, opts); end); it("demands values for value params", function() local opts, err, where = parse({ "--foo" }, { value_params = { foo = true } }); assert.falsy(opts); assert.equal("missing-value", err); assert.equal("--foo", where); end); it("reports where the problem is", function() local opts, err, where = parse({ "-h" }); assert.falsy(opts); assert.equal("param-not-found", err); assert.equal("-h", where, "returned where"); end); it("supports array arguments", function () do local opts, err = parse({ "--item"; "foo"; "--item"; "bar" }, { array_params = { item = true } }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({"foo","bar"}, opts.item); end do -- Same test with strict mode enabled local opts, err = parse({ "--item"; "foo"; "--item"; "bar" }, { array_params = { item = true }, strict = true }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same({"foo","bar"}, opts.item); end end) it("rejects unknown parameters in strict mode", function () local opts, err, err2 = parse({ "--item"; "foo"; "--item"; "bar", "--foobar" }, { array_params = { item = true }, strict = true }); assert.falsy(opts); assert.same("param-not-found", err); assert.same("--foobar", err2); end); it("accepts known kv parameters in strict mode", function () local opts, err = parse({ "--item=foo" }, { kv_params = { item = true }, strict = true }); assert.falsy(err); assert.same("foo", opts.item); end); end);
